Golden Bay Brawl: One Man Hospitalized, Another Arrested
In the early hours of Sunday morning, the peaceful ambiance of Golden Bay was shattered as a fight broke out, leaving one man hospitalized and another behind bars. The incident, which took place at around 2:30 AM, has left locals and tourists alike shocked and questioning the safety of Malta’s popular beaches.
What Happened at Golden Bay?
Witnesses report that the brawl started as a verbal altercation between two groups of young men near the beach’s car park. According to eyewitness statements, the argument quickly escalated into a full-blown fight, with punches thrown and chairs broken. The chaos lasted for several minutes before police arrived to break up the fight.
One man, a 23-year-old from Msida, was found unconscious on the ground and was immediately taken to Mater Dei Hospital. He is currently in stable condition, suffering from a suspected concussion and facial injuries. Another man, a 25-year-old from St. Julian’s, was arrested at the scene and is currently being held at the St. Julian’s Police Station.
Police Response and Investigation
The Malta Police Force has confirmed that they are treating the incident as grievous bodily harm and are currently investigating the events leading up to the fight. Superintendent Martin Fenech, who is leading the investigation, has appealed to anyone who may have witnessed the incident to come forward with information.
“We are appealing to anyone who may have seen what happened to get in touch with us,” Fenech said. “We are particularly interested in speaking to anyone who may have captured footage of the incident on their mobile phones.”
Golden Bay: A Haven Under Threat?
Golden Bay, located on Malta’s northwest coast, is one of the island’s most popular beaches, drawing both locals and tourists with its crystal-clear waters and stunning sunsets. However, this is not the first time that the beach has made headlines for the wrong reasons. In recent years, there have been several incidents of anti-social behavior and violence at the beach, leading some to question whether the area is becoming less safe.
Local councillor, Alexiei Dingli, has called for increased police presence in the area, particularly during peak hours. “Golden Bay is a jewel in Malta’s crown, but it’s clear that more needs to be done to ensure the safety of those who visit,” Dingli said. “We need to see a visible police presence, not just at peak times, but throughout the day and night.”
The Ministry for Tourism has also weighed in on the incident, expressing its concern and vowing to work with local authorities to ensure the safety of tourists and locals alike. “Incidents like this are not reflective of the welcoming and safe environment that we strive to maintain in Malta,” a spokesperson said. “We are committed to working with the police and local councils to ensure that our beaches remain safe and enjoyable for all.”
